What a mess in St. Louis. They were in pretty much the same boat as Detroit, having to cut their payroll in half to come in under the salary cap, but while the Wings have flourished (winless Northwest road swing notwithstanding), St. Louis is a disaster area. Gross mismanagement in the past has left them saddled with contracts they can't get rid of, like the $11.4 million they have tied up in Doug Weight and Keith Tkachuk (between the two of them, they've only made it to the second round of the playoffs six times in 25 seasons).
